Asante Kotoko SC goalkeeper Razak Abalora is close to completing a move to Moldovan giants FC Sheriff Tiraspol. The 25-year-old will arrive in Tiraspol in a few days to complete other details of his transfer after passing a medical examination, his outfit Asante Kotoko has been in negotiations with the Moldova team. The ex WAFA graduate is likely to sign a four to five years contract with Sheriff which will make him teammates to Ghanaian compatriots Edmund Addo and Abdul Basit Khalid when he joins the Moldovan side. Host nation Cameroon came from behind to stun Burkina Faso 2-1 in the opener of the Africa Cup of Nations. Gustavo Sangare’s acrobatic volley placed the Burkinabe ahead halfway through the first half at a fully-packed Olembe Stadium. But two unerring penalties from captain Vincent Aboubakar turned the game around for the lions before half-time. Ajax keeper Andre Onana made two important second-half saves as Toni Conceicao’s side opened their Group A campaign with a victory. Ex-Hearts of Oak midfielder, Emmanuel Nettey has moved to Iraqi Division One side Duhok Sports Club. The midfielder signed a one-year deal with the club as a free agent. The 27-year-old joined the Phobia’s from Inter Allies in 2019, was part of Accra Hearts of Oak squad that won the Ghana Premier League and FA Cup last season. He departed from the Accra-based side last month after the expiration of his contract and has sealed a deal in Iraq. He featured 17 times for the Rainbow club. African Cup of Nations host country, Cameroon is the latest to announce several coronavirus cases in their camp. The Indomitable Lions face Burkina Faso in the first game of the tournament on 9 January. The Cameroon Football Federation said Pierre Kunde Malong, Jean Efala, Michael Ngadeu Ngadjui and Christian Bassogog had been under observation since Wednesday because of “strong suspicions” they had the virus, and the quartet will continue to quarantine.
